Winter golf in Montana!
Set up in winter time when the ball golf course is closed.
Plays along the Yellowstone River with epic views of the Crazy Mountains to the north and the Absoroka Mountains to the south. Both rise over 6500' above the valley floor.
Bald and Golden Eagles will be there EVERY time you play.
Awesome use of the terrain with 3 par 4's (6,11,17)
Hole 12 has a double mandatory between the 2 obvious trees.
If you do not pass through the mandatory trees, take a penalty stroke and throw from anywhere between the mandatory trees.
Hole 15 is an island created by the cart path. Played as BUNCR.
Play from where Disc came to rest with one stroke penalty.
All tarp covered greens and sand bunkers are OB.
As this area is known for wind, part of the design is based on having to play every angle related to the wind. Head wind, tail wind, right to left, left to right and everything in between.

Other Thoughts:
Only open in winter but the pads are shoveled constantly and the wind generally removes the snow once a week.
